WebMar 23, 2024 · All children under 19 years of age who are eligible for Medi-Cal even if they are unable to establish satisfactory immigration status are now eligible for full-scope benefits. Benefits Your child gets medical care, vision exams, dental care, substance abuse treatment, and mental health services that are available under Medi-Cal. WebOct 3, 2024 · Children need quality healthcare to grow into healthy adults. Research shows that children who have health insurance coverage are more likely to receive the preventive care they need to avoid medical problems that require costly and painful treatment. When income is received on an irregular, non-recurring, or one-time basis, the court may average or prorate the income over a specified period of time or require an obligor to pay as child support a percentage of his or her non-recurring income that is equivalent to the percentage of his or her recurring income paid for child support.

Then add the percentage listed in the tables for the portion of income over $150,000. space engineers small battle cruiserWebTax filer + spouse + tax dependents = household. Follow these basic rules when including members of your household: Include your spouse if you’re legally married. If you plan to claim someone as a tax dependent for the year you want coverage, do include them on your application.
